The VIN is correct (and it is an 86). From visually inspection I can also confirm this is not an ASC (nor is it being represented as one). The pics in the most recent CL listing are just really crappy. The seats DO have the RED piping. The sail panels do NOT have the filler pieces. It is however an RS, well, what would have been an RS in previous years anyway (it has "CRS" on the buck tag).
It needs paint. Apparently the last time it was painted it had 87+ Mustang GT side skirts on it and it was painted with them on it. Now without them the sides of the car below the molding need to be painted in order to match the rest of the car. The air dam needs some repair and paint.
There is a bit more than surface rust on the underside of the hatch. The drivers side floor has a significant crack at the rear of the front seat. There is some rust at the front of the footwells and on the outside of the hatch.
Engines runs strong, but the engine compartment is bare - i.e. the heater hoses and A/C hoses are gone, as are all the emissions hoses. As stated in the ad, the fuel injection has been removed and the car is now carbureted.
It needs tires. Interior is not as nice as described. There's a couple holes in the seat fabric, the dash has a cap on it, the panels are loose and the carpet is stained (but may be savable). The hatch is misaligned and the latch isn't working correctly. It has an aftermarket sunroof. The McLaren wing needs help.
If you want a Capri to bomb around in, or a drag car, or a resto project, this may be an option.
